Cavanaugh Gray

Cavanaugh currently serves as Startup Specialist for The Entrepreneur Cafe, LLC. With over two decades of experience, he helps organizations scale through improved managerial expertise and processes, digital marketing strategies that improve return on investment, growth through access to capital, and leveraging of critical organizational resources.

Over the years, Cavanaugh has used his expertise to address a variety of social issues. As the Executive Director of the Young Entrepreneurs Program (YEP), he provided alternatives to unemployment, low-paying jobs, and destructive life choices for hundreds of students ages 12-18 through entrepreneurship and financial literacy training.  

As Executive Director of Project Compassion, he managed partnership and stakeholder collaborations, implemented long-term strategies, program development, budget oversight, and oversaw the efforts of 100 volunteers that helped 65 families transition out of homeless.  

Most recently, Cavanaugh served as Commissioner for the Village of Downers Grove, IL, a municipality of 50,000 residents. As commissioner, he helped implement the long-range plans and analyzed and approved tax levies, utility rates, zoning requirements, and other fees.  In addition, he reviewed, revised, and approved Downer’s Grove’s $49 million annual operating budget and COVID-19 Financial Response Plan that helped close a multi-million dollar budget shortfall. Cavanaugh used his platform to advance conversations around social change, diversity, equity, and inclusion among Downers Grove residents. 

Cavanaugh has served as a business advisor to a Chicago Innovation Award Winner, has dozens of published articles, and is the author of The Entrepreneurial Spirit Lives (a 2016 Amazon Top Read) and Bridging the Entrepreneurial Divide. He has served as an adjunct professor of Integrated Brand Promotion and Small Business Management (Entrepreneurship). Cavanaugh holds a bachelor’s degree in finance and marketing and a Certification in Entrepreneurial Studies from the University of Illinois at Chicago. He also has a Certification in Digital Marketing Strategies from Northwestern University Kellogg’s Executive Education Program.

A diehard Chicagoan, he is the son of a retired Chicago Public School Teacher and Chicago firefighter. As a Baumhart Scholar, Cavanaugh will look to work at the convergence of the corporate, nonprofit, and startup landscapes to assist in bringing economic equity to underserved communities.
